About

This is a fun Bushcraft session. Learn to make a fire using just a flint & Steel, boil some water on your fire to make a hot drink. Once the fire is going we will use knife skills to craft some bush bling. Make some beads, a tent peg, whistle or even start carving a spoon..

Adventure Tips

Dress for woodland conditions

Wear durable clothing that can handle dirt and wood shavings, as this hands-on activity gets you close to the natural elements.

Bring a reusable cup

Enjoy a hot drink brewed over your fire in a sustainable way by bringing your own mug or cup.

Prior knife safety

Pay close attention during knife skill instruction to handle carving tools safely and confidently.

Arrive on time

The 2.5-hour session is tightly scheduled; arriving late means missing crucial parts of the lesson.
